TRUMP CRITICIZES NON-WORKING HOLIDAYS ON JUNETEENTH
Former President Donald Trump is speaking out about America’s holidays. He took to Truth Social on Juneteenth to voice his concerns. Trump says the U.S. has “too many non-working holidays.” He claims they cost the country billions of dollars in lost business. Trump also says most workers don’t even want the extra days off. He warned that soon we could have more holidays than workdays. In his post, Trump called for change to protect the economy. He ended his message with his signature line, “MAKE AMERICA GREAT AGAIN!” The post has sparked a lot of reaction online. Some supporters agree with his focus on the economy. Others say his timing — on Juneteenth — felt disrespectful. And so, the debate over holidays continues.
